    Define the observable result expected for each reviewed duty for Five Dock. The standard replaces general satisfaction wording with a usable baseline.

  2. 2

    Inspection sample

    Choose zones and tasks that represent the active workload for Five Dock. The sample makes a review proportionate and repeatable.

  3. 3

    Issue record

    Capture the area, observation, expected interval and responsible contact for Five Dock. The record connects feedback to the approved service document.

  4. 4

    Corrective action

    State the authorised response and completion evidence for Five Dock. The action remains traceable until the agreed issue is closed.
